    My fiance is a true southern man who loves his grandma's meatloaf, so I was concerned about preparing meatloaf.
    He loved this. I used my own glaze:
    (1/3 C. ketchup, 2 TBSP. brown sugar and 1 TBSP. mustard, which I spread on top of the loaf to bake and leave the extra on the side for dipping. It's sweet and glazes the entire loaf. It was moist, meaty and left you wanting more. This meatloaf has excellent flavor and is forever in my recipe box. Try it... your family will love it!

    Excellent flavor...I used 1 lb of pork vs. 1/2 lb pork and 1/2 lb veal with the ground beef and substituted milk for the cream. Also, instead of Baby Bam I used Essence for a little extra kick. My wife, who doesn't like meatloaf, cleaned her plate!
